The front bumper is rounded out quite a bit, but there is almost no room in the engine compartment. The radiator and front cross member are much further behind the front of the bumber and the intercooler.
There is only about 2" between the turbo and the radiator, which is why there is that huge exit air vent right above, to get rid of all that heat.
